2026/4/18 21:52:25
网站建设
项目流程
wordpress无法上传文件,seo基础入门视频教程,建筑企业登录哪个网站,网站 粘度快速体验
打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容#xff1a;
开发一个电商商品CSV处理工具#xff0c;功能包括#xff1a;1. 将数据库中的商品信息导出为CSV 2. 支持通过CSV批量修改商品价格和库存 3. 自动校验CSV格式和数据的有效性 4. 生…快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容开发一个电商商品CSV处理工具功能包括1. 将数据库中的商品信息导出为CSV 2. 支持通过CSV批量修改商品价格和库存 3. 自动校验CSV格式和数据的有效性 4. 生成修改报告。要求使用Python编写包含异常处理和数据验证逻辑。优先使用deepseek模型生成。点击项目生成按钮等待项目生成完整后预览效果今天想和大家分享一个电商运营中非常实用的技巧——用CSV文件批量管理商品数据。作为电商从业者经常需要处理大量商品的上架、调价和库存更新手动操作不仅效率低还容易出错。下面我就结合自己开发的工具说说如何用Python实现这个需求。数据导出功能实现 首先需要从数据库导出商品信息。我设计了一个Python脚本通过连接MySQL数据库执行查询语句获取商品ID、名称、价格、库存等关键字段。这里特别注意要处理数据库连接异常比如网络中断或权限问题。导出的CSV文件会包含表头方便后续编辑。CSV批量修改功能 修改功能是核心部分。脚本会读取用户编辑后的CSV文件逐行解析数据。这里有几个关键点价格修改需要验证是否为有效数字库存值必须是非负整数商品ID要确保在数据库中存在 为了提高效率我采用了批量更新的方式而不是逐条操作数据库。数据校验机制 数据安全很重要所以加入了严格的校验检查CSV文件格式是否正确验证必填字段是否完整对价格和库存进行范围检查确认商品ID的有效性 发现问题时脚本会立即停止处理并给出明确错误提示。报告生成功能 每次操作后脚本会自动生成详细的报告成功修改的记录数失败的记录及原因修改前后的数据对比 这样运营同学可以清楚知道操作结果方便后续跟进。在实际使用中这个工具帮我们团队节省了大量时间。以前手动修改1000个商品的价格需要半天现在几分钟就能完成。特别是大促期间的调价需求再也不用加班处理了。异常处理经验 开发过程中遇到几个坑值得分享编码问题CSV文件可能有不同编码现在统一转为UTF-8处理数据格式用户可能在Excel中误操作导致数据变形增加了格式检查性能优化大数据量时改用生成器逐行处理避免内存溢出这个项目我是在InsCode(快马)平台上完成的最方便的是可以直接部署成Web服务让运营同事通过网页上传CSV文件就能使用。平台内置的Python环境省去了配置的麻烦一键部署特别适合我们这种需要快速落地的场景。如果你也有类似需求不妨试试这个方案。快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容开发一个电商商品CSV处理工具功能包括1. 将数据库中的商品信息导出为CSV 2. 支持通过CSV批量修改商品价格和库存 3. 自动校验CSV格式和数据的有效性 4. 生成修改报告。要求使用Python编写包含异常处理和数据验证逻辑。优先使用deepseek模型生成。点击项目生成按钮等待项目生成完整后预览效果